Sunday, Keith and Matt gathered up the cows and finally got them caught up on their yearly vaccinations and worming. A day that we never seem to look forward to, but it sure makes you feel good when your animals are up to date and healthy. Tina and I vaccinated the last batch of lambs that were weaned. Ear tag for identification, wormed and vaccinated them for tetanus and over eating. Some of the little ones were limping, so we had to sit them down and trim their feet. The lambs are so much easier to work with than the cows.
